Post Adoption: Month 9 & 10



The school year has ended and summer is upon us. Our sweet Maggie has been home with us for a full 10 months! We are starting to prepare our 1 year report and can not believe it! I remember last summer, being so close to bringing her home, but still so much to to do and so many miles between us. Now, we are home and ready for our first full summer as a family of 6!



Food and Growth:
Maggie is growing so much! We are down to 1 bottle in the morning now and she will drink from her cup without issues. She likes to use her fork, but still struggles with yogurt and a spoon! She loves fruit, cheese and more fruit. We are working on getting more varieties in her...but she is a very typical 2 yr old.
The doctors are pleased with her growth and that it continues to climb. She is still a bit small for her age, but has put on 5 full pounds in 10 months.

Health:
While Maggie is doing great, we will be doing a small eye procedure for her in July. Both of her tear ducts are blocked, so she will have out patient surgery to have those opened up. Because of her age, she will have to be put under, but it is a simple procedure with no post-op issues. I am nervous for the anesthesia, as I am not sure how she will react when she comes out, but I am thankful that in 10 months, we will only have had one small procedure.


Development:

After weeks of evaluations and meetings, we have finally started speech therapy for Maggie. She is slooooowly adding more words, but not at the speed she should be. So, we are hoping that this will help her communicate with us. Macy is anxiously awaiting the time that she will be able to have full conversations with her sister!
